Solar panels for a small gym outside my house?

We Answered:

The answer depends on how long you would be running the AC, how many watts it draws, and where you are located.

I'll do the math with some guesses to get you in the range.

If we guess 500W for the air conditioner and running for 8 hours, that's 4000 watt hours (Wh) a day. I assume this would be in the summer, so let's say 6 sun hours a day (that is different from hours of sun, it is a standard rate used to size systems). You would need about 1000W (or 1kW) of solar panels. If this was a battery based system, so it can run any time, you would need a battery bank about 48V at 250ah. You'd also need the inverter, mounting equipment, and safety equipment for the whole system. I hope you're sitting down, this system would cost about $10k. Unfortunately, anytime you try to make hot or cold, it uses a lot of electricity.
